This resource provides detailed comparison group data for every indicator evaluated for each distinction designation. It allows you to sort any distinction designation indicator and determine how a particular campus was measured against all other campuses in the comparison group. Indicator values displayed with a green background indicate that a campus was in the top quartile for that indicator.
